PER CURIAM.
The appellant challenges the order by which the trial court summarily denied his Florida Rule of Criminal Procedure 3.850 motion for postconviction relief. One of the appellant's claims was that he would not have pled to the offenses but for his trial attorney's promise that his convictions would be reversed on appeal.
